Claim Adjuster applicants have rated the interview process at Progressive Insurance with 3.3 out of 5 (where 5 is the highest level of difficulty) and assessed their interview experience as 54% positive. To compare, the company-average is 60.4% positive. This is according to Glassdoor user ratings.
Candidates applying for Claim Adjuster roles take an average of 24 days to get hired, when considering 435 user submitted interviews for this role. To compare, the hiring process at Progressive Insurance overall takes an average of 25 days.
Common stages of the interview process at Progressive Insurance as a Claim Adjuster according to 435 Glassdoor interviews include:
Phone interview: 22%
Skills test: 15%
One on one interview: 13%
Background check: 13%
Personality test: 13%
IQ intelligence test: 9%
Presentation: 5%
Drug test: 5%
Group panel interview: 4%
Other: 1%
